Effects of Deflected Wing Tips on the Aerodynamic Characteristics of a Canard Configuration at Mach Numbers from 0.7 to 3.5

Abstract
Aerodynamic characteristics of canard configuration at subsonic and supersonic speeds with deflected wing tips for longitudinal and directional stability
